Links And Resource Boxes
Written by Craig S. Andrews
A resource box is an area at the end of an article containing the name of the author, his or her expertise and description of the site along with a link. If a reader likes the article and wants to read more, the chances are they will click on this link to the source of the article and go to the site to find more information.
Think of it as adding your business card to your project; a personal and yet professional touch to gently drive people toward your website.
This of course, is the key to bringing in targeted traffic and backlinks. Part of optimizing your article submission is to make sure you have plenty of relevant links and an interesting, eye-catching resource box.
Naturally, it is preferable that the article topic is related to the site content. The links in an article should lead to relevant sites that market products or services that are in some way connected to the subject matter of the article.
The foremost benefit of a good resource box is to drive targeted traffic to your website or Internet business. Many sites allow articles to be placed on their sites for content fillers. Traffic generated are potential customers and they may very well become future customers.
You can also combine your marketing and customer service through opt-in marketing. A resource box with a link to your opt-in page gives you get the opportunity to introduce your site and products all at the same time, while building your list.
Building an opt-in marketing strategy by way of publishing articles is one of the most cost effective ways to market on the Internet today.
Well-written articles full of useful information will help in building your list as well as generating sales and ultimately, profits for your business.
